Understanding the Immediate Steps Post-Accident
Assessing Injuries and Safety
The most importantly action after a cars and truck accident is ensuring everybody's safety. Check yourself and others for injuries. If possible, transfer to a safe place away from traffic. If someone is hurt, call emergency services immediately.
Key Points:
- Ensure safety first Call for medical assistance Avoid moving seriously hurt individuals unless necessary
Calling the Authorities
Once everyone is safe, it is necessary to get in touch with police. A police report will record the event and supply a main account that may be important for insurance declares later on.
Exchanging Information
Gather essential details from all celebrations involved in the accident:

- Names and contact details Insurance details Vehicle registration numbers Driver's license numbers
This info is vital for any legal proceedings or insurance claims that might follow.
What to Do After a Car Accident: Legal Considerations
Documenting the Scene
Taking pictures of the mishap scene can be indispensable when submitting claims or pursuing legal action. Capture images of:
- Vehicle damage Skid marks or debris Road conditions Traffic signs

Notify your insurance company promptly. Provide them with all needed documentation. Follow up regularly on claim status updates.Common Mistakes to Avoid After an Accident
Admitting Fault at the Scene
One of the greatest mistakes you can make is confessing fault right away following a mishap. It's suggested to prevent talking about fault till all truths are gathered.
Failing to Seek Medical Attention Immediately
Even if injuries appear small, it's important to get inspected by a healthcare expert right now; some injuries may not manifest symptoms immediately.

Dealing with Insurance Adjusters
Insurance adjusters are frequently skilled arbitrators who may attempt to decrease your compensation offer. Beware when consulting with them; it's a good idea to speak with your attorney beforehand.
Understanding Medical Expenses Coverage
One substantial aspect of healing includes comprehending how medical costs will be covered:
Health insurance might cover some costs. Your auto insurance provider may supply medical payments coverage. If another celebration is at fault, they may eventually be responsible for your medical bills.What to Do After a Car Mishap: Filing a Suit if Necessary

2. For how long do I have to sue after my automobile accident?
In California, you usually have 2 years from the date of the accident to file an accident claim.
3. Can I still recuperate damages if I was partly at fault?
Yes, California follows relative carelessness laws which allow you to recuperate damages even if you're partially at fault; however, your compensation might be decreased accordingly.
